As professionals in the game design industry look to advance their careers, it's essential to understand the roles and areas that are driving growth and innovation.
This chart provides a snapshot of the career landscape in game design impact measurement, highlighting the key areas and roles that are shaping the future of the industry.
Data Analyst (20%) - Responsible for analyzing and interpreting data to inform design decisions and measure the impact of games on players.
Game Designer (25%) - Creates engaging and immersive game experiences, working closely with developers, artists, and other team members to bring the game to life.
UX Researcher (18%) - Conducts research to understand player behavior, preferences, and needs, informing design decisions and ensuring a positive player experience.
Game Producer (37%) - Oversees the entire game development process, from concept to launch, ensuring timely and within budget delivery of the final product.
